代码改变世界

水仙花数

2022-05-17 13:44 by 钟铧若岩, 264 阅读, 0 推荐, 收藏, 编辑
摘要:打印出所有的 水仙花数 ,所谓 水仙花数 是指一个三位数,其各位数字立方和等于该数本身。 例如:153是一个 水仙花数 ,因为153=1的三次方+5的三次方+3的三次方 1 public void Test11() { 2 for (int i = 100; i <= 999; i++) { 3 i 阅读全文

将一个正整数分解质因数。例如:输入90,打印出90=2*3*3*5

2022-05-16 17:16 by 钟铧若岩, 53 阅读, 0 推荐, 收藏, 编辑
摘要:1.程序分析:对n进行分解质因数,应先找到一个最小的质数i,然后按下述步骤完成: (1)如果这个质数恰等于n,则说明分解质因数的过程已经结束,打印出即可。 (2)如果n > i,但n能被i整除,则应打印出i的值,并用n除以i的商,作为新的正整数你,重复执行第一步。 (3)如果n不能被i整除,则用i+ 阅读全文

输入三个整数x,y,z,请把这三个数由小到大输出

2022-05-16 17:10 by 钟铧若岩, 17 阅读, 0 推荐, 收藏, 编辑
摘要:后面补充 阅读全文

乘法口诀表

2022-05-16 17:07 by 钟铧若岩, 354 阅读, 0 推荐, 收藏, 编辑
摘要:全矩形 1 for (int i = 1; i <= 9; i++) { 2 for (int j = 1; j <= 9; j++) { 3 System.out.print(i + "*" + j + "=" + (i*j) + "\t"); 4 } 5 System.out.println() 阅读全文

猴子摘桃子问题

2022-05-16 16:54 by 钟铧若岩, 59 阅读, 0 推荐, 收藏, 编辑
摘要:猴子吃桃问题: 猴子第一天摘下若干个桃子,当即吃了一半,还不瘾,又多吃了一个 第二天早上又将剩下的桃子吃掉一半,又多吃了一个。 以后每天早上都吃了前一天剩下的一半零一个。 到第10天早上想再吃时,见只剩下一个桃子了。 求第一天共摘了多少? 1 public static void main(Stri 阅读全文

题目:求1+2!+3!+...+20!的和。

2022-05-16 16:21 by 钟铧若岩, 30 阅读, 0 推荐, 收藏, 编辑
摘要:1 public void Test8(){ 2 long sum = 0; 3 long fac = 1; 4 for (int i = 1; i <= 20; i++) { 5 fac = fac * i; 6 sum += fac; 7 } 8 System.out.println(sum); 阅读全文

有一分数序列:2/1,3/2,5/3,8/5,13/8,21/13...求出这个数列的前20项之和

2022-05-16 16:17 by 钟铧若岩, 28 阅读, 0 推荐, 收藏, 编辑
摘要:这里就不要使用数列递归公式了 1 public void Test7() { 2 float fm = 1.0f; 3 float fz = 1.0f; 4 float temp; 5 float sum = 0f; 6 7 for (int i = 0; i < 20; i++) { 8 temp 阅读全文

多项式计算公式

2022-05-15 07:46 by 钟铧若岩, 14 阅读, 0 推荐, 收藏, 编辑
摘要:接下来补充 阅读全文

0-1背包问题

2022-05-13 16:59 by 钟铧若岩, 33 阅读, 0 推荐, 收藏, 编辑
摘要:1 package com.company; 2 3 import org.junit.Test; 4 5 public class BeiBao01 { 6 7 8 /* 9 * 根据之前已经引出的状态转移方程,我们再来理解一遍,对于编号为 i 的物品: 10 11 如果选择它,那么,当前背包的最 阅读全文

拆半查找算法

2022-05-13 16:58 by 钟铧若岩, 29 阅读, 0 推荐, 收藏, 编辑
摘要:1 package com.company; 2 3 import org.junit.Test; 4 5 public class BinarySearchNonRecursive { 6 7 private static int binarySearch(int[] arr, int targe 阅读全文
上一页 1 ··· 3 4 5 6 7 8 9 下一页